SABLE ISLAND CYØS TEAM ANNOUNCES DXPEDITION DATES

The Sable Island CYØS team has announced that their DXpedition has been scheduled for March 19th through to either the 30th or 31st of next year. The operation received its approval this past spring from parks officials in Canada but the dates in March were not set at the time.

The group said that it has been fundraising to cover the higher costs of flights between Halifax, Nova Scotia and the island - a significant increase, they said, since the 2023 DXpedition. The island is about 300 km, or 186 miles, east of Halifax.

The treeless and windy island, best known for its population of wild horses, is expected to pose a number of challenges during the expedition. The team leaders will be Murray WA4DAN and Glenn WØGJ. Operators will be joined by a number of members of last year's CY9C DXpedition to St. Paul Island, also off the coast of Nova Scotia.
